Rugby sevens: fans react to New Zealand defeat

Thursday, August 11 2016 by SNTV
  • Fans reacted on Tuesday (9th August) to New Zealand's shock 14-12 defeat at the hands of Japan in the two sides' opening game of the men's Olympic rugby sevens.

    There was an early upset in the men's Olympic rugby sevens, as New Zealand - one of the favourites for the gold medal - were beaten 14-12 by Japan.

    And fans outside the stadium, reacted to the result:

    SOUNDBITE (English): Chris Ferguson, New Zealand fan:

    "It's been a tough start to the Olympics for the New Zealand team. We didn't do that well in the start and lost to Japan for the first time, I think in the history of our game. So it's scary, it's scary at the moment. I'm emotionally scared."

    Elsewhere in the tournament Australia were beaten by an impressive French side, whilst Argentina narrowly beat the USA. And American fans were on hand to assess the development of the sport in their country:

    SOUNDBITE (English): Jeff Brook, USA fan:

    "This Olympics is awesome for Rugby in America. This develops programs, puts it on the main stage, this is exactly what America needs to develop - a Rugby program. It just puts so much emphasis on the game, and we see it developing from the junior levels to the high, we love it."

    Team GB opened their campaign with a comfortable 31-7 victory over Kenya. The top two sides in each of the three pools go into the quarter-finals, plus the two best third-placed teams.
